I am wondering whether there is any demand for a translation capability for the text displayed in the UI (but not card data). I have been working on refactoring out all the UI text strings to a single consolidated class and a nice consequence of this is that it is now easy to override the default English text by supplying a simple text file with the translations (see attached for example). As mentioned, this will have no effect on the actual card data but it would make things like the preferences dialog easier to use which contains lots of help text for each setting.

There is now a mechanism in place for translating the Magarena user interface. @PalladiaMors has kindly offered to put it through its paces and has already begun work on a portuguese translation. If anyone else is interested, full instructions can be found on the Magarena wiki. You will also need the latest 1.64 build. I hope to use the rest of this month to iron out any problems before the official 1.64 release so any help or feedback will be most appreciated.
